Transaction e28cebf97d7ebedebc7018260f1ae71423f008c5108b89d31aa969857db8ebb6

21 Input
2 Outputs
  • e28cebf97d7ebedebc7018260f1ae71423f008c5108b89d31aa969857db8ebb6:0
  • value  809490
    address  3BQr8iNfyeXJgGZrq4x6EZTLSjskBPKZfV
  • e28cebf97d7ebedebc7018260f1ae71423f008c5108b89d31aa969857db8ebb6:1
  • value  1200101
    address  173EpZ35zLFsfoo1f34YS3GrjAjRvBeHRs